Jason Penman

Mr. Penman works with clients to understand and manage risk, liquidity, capital and balance sheet effectively. He also supports clients on complex disputes and investigations involving capital markets issues.
Mr. Penman’s notable recent experience includes developing regulatory models and processes to improve IRRBB, ICAAP/ILAAPs, stress testing, and recovery/resolution plans. He has also supported clients responding to regulatory scrutiny and identifying capital and balance sheet optimisation opportunities. In disputes and investigations, his recent projects include litigation related to complex notes and exotic hedging products.
Prior to joining A&M, Mr. Penman worked as a Managing Director and Head of Capital & Balance Sheet Management at Nat West. He built and led a multi-discipline team over a 10-year period, directly managing and optimizing bank risk, capital, liquidity and balance sheet. He also worked in the management team to re-shape the business and was responsible for identifying and managing extensive legacy risk issues.
Previously, Mr. Penman served as a Business CFO, Head of Strategy & Planning at Bank of America Merrill Lynch (Europe) and held risk management positions. He was also CFO and part of the management team in a start-up specialist lending business.
Mr. Penman earned a bachelor's degree in law and is a qualified accountant.
